Output e618ab4d27ba96379a70594ee199c818cdc979e5408077fab030bd8c9995ff44:2

value
120699317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fa8f6f45a1c35ae79f2aa80cc3c9e5db0c2527 OP_EQUAL
address
MTDzy97UfkA5WjRnkiWaiH8wWhcKsspt5R
transaction
e618ab4d27ba96379a70594ee199c818cdc979e5408077fab030bd8c9995ff44
spent
true